HotTopics: News Publishers Move To Capture Community-Created Content For Growth

Image of Ken Doctor

Author: Ken Doctor, Affiliate Analyst

In this HotTopics, Outsell takes a fresh look at user-generated publishing and addresses essential points for news publishers, who in 2007 must move from grudging acceptance to a full-fledged embrace of the user-generated phenomenon to remain competitive.

In this HotTopics you will:
- Understand what user-generated content is and isn’t, and learn about its evolving forms
- Get practical examples of stand-alone and integrated publishing models
- Learn about a new generation of vendors that provide licensed software/Web services for user-generated content
- Discover social publishing revenue models that are in the early stages of testing
- Get real-life advice and how-tos on topics like staffing, community-sizing, and branding for user-generated content sites
